5 EASY FACTS ABOUT DAPP VIDEO DESCRIBED

5 Easy Facts About dapp video Described

5 Easy Facts About dapp video Described

Blog Article

We'd like to have your supporting hand on generate-web3-dapp! See contributing.md For more info on what we are searching for and the way to get rolling.

And The very last thing We've is a extremely simple consumer interface wherever Now we have a kind, in which We now have two buttons. a single for fetching the greeting and contacting fetchGreeting. And one other for setting the greeting. And Now we have an input for allowing the person to update the greeting.

React screening Library is a wonderful framework for React element exams because There are plenty of thoughts it solutions for yourself, which means you don’t want to worry about Those people questions. But that doesn’t mean tests is simple.

We applied the get balance perform to retrieve the token harmony with the user. We also applied the send out cash purpose to approve and transfer tokens between parties. We updated the user interface to incorporate buttons for obtaining the stability and sending the coins, along with type inputs for your user account and total. at last, we imported the token handle into our copyright wallet to watch the token equilibrium.

Create web3 dapp provides you with entry to a library of output ready, web3 apps to kickstart your project with. NFTs Explorer, and even more coming quickly.

Alright, so I am gonna go ahead and start copying and pasting a number of this code and strolling through it. So I'm going to open up up dot j s. And right here we're importing use state. From react, which will likely be what we're utilizing to cope with community state. we are importing the ethers library from ethers, which will probably be how we interact with the community. after which we're importing this greeter ABI, which happens to be right here in artifacts slash contracts slash reader dot soul slash reader dot JSON. So once more, that's the ABI. upcoming, we wish to go ahead and define the deal with of our agreement. And that was logged out to your terminal for the next back. So I should manage to go to my terminal and copy that to my clipboard here. paste it there. another thing we wish to do is go ahead and determine the app. which is going to be our most important element. We'll go ahead and configure our application. And this will be our principal component. We will go on and click here configure our nearby state. And the one point out variable that we'd like to cope with at this moment will probably be the greeting and location the greeting worth. by doing this the consumer can key in what they need the greeting to be current to after which we can basically send a brand new transaction to update that value. the following detail We will do is form of fascinating is We will Have got a function known as request account. Now this is de facto totally new to a lot of people also to myself when I started out dealing with Ethereum. It is fascinating for a pair unique causes. First off, when anyone includes a wallet like copyright or Phantom or Arweave put in inside their browser, what essentially transpires Besides us gaining access to this wallet is the fact it injects a global variable into the context with the window identified as Ethereum or Arweave or In this instance Solana. So we mainly have access to a little something referred to as window.ethereum. which has lots of various things that we can easily do now, given that We now have this mounted. And now in the event you attempted to run this, this purpose over a browser that did not have this, you just get an mistake. Just what exactly you could do when you planned to style of perform some mistake managing, you could possibly say if window.ethereum after which you can you would possibly, you know, do things. But we are just assuming this exists.

m. Pacific time. It will be 1 thirty five p.m. japanese time. And I'm unsure enough time in Europe in which you where you are, but as an instance 35 minutes once the hour. And I might be hanging out consuming coffee and I might be looking at issues on Discord. And that i might be hanging out drinking espresso and I will be looking at thoughts on Discord. And that i is going to be trying out inquiries on Discord. And I will probably be trying out thoughts on Discord. And I might be trying out inquiries on Discord.

Let's now deploy our dApp to IPFS. We are going to again use the thirdweb CLI. So, run this command to deploy your application:

Whether you are acquiring reducing-edge AI apps, groundbreaking new gaming platforms, revolutionizing DeFi, or contributing to the future of decentralized social networks, your Strategies and innovations are the driving power at the rear of the evolution of your BNB Chain ecosystem.

We now have 15 strains of code that accomplish this. following saving the deal, we compile it and update the deploy script to include the token deployment. We attain a reference to the token contract and watch for the deployment to achieve success, logging the token address. many addresses can be programmed in the deal to distribute tokens amid events.

And I'd want to deliver like, you are aware of, a hundred ETH to that deal with. really should be able to go here and now see that I've one hundred. And this is similar to what We'll be doing in only a second. But We will be undertaking it with our very own tokens that we create and We'll be accomplishing it programmatically by means of a entrance conclusion software.

Okay, so since we have set up our dependencies, let's keep on heading. So given that we have gotten our undertaking create, we can now generate and configure our tough hat atmosphere, which again is our Ethereum advancement atmosphere. And to do this, all we must do is operate NPX challenging hat. So I'm going to go on and try this. Therefore if I run NPX tricky hat, This could go ahead and scaffold out a tough hat task. And We have now a few of different alternatives.

Technical phrases include strain and make extra friction for adoption. Therefore, pare down your language and help it become simple for most of the people to be aware of.

No Configuration needed: You needn't configure something. a fairly good configuration of both equally enhancement and generation builds is managed in your case so you can aim on composing code.

Report this page